I like hiking the Albany County Rail Trail, but not so much now that the nicer weather is here. There is just too much in crowds, too many bicycles, too many leisurely strollers, too many runners, too many kids, just generally too many people on the trail during the summer months.

I have to wonder if the county under-estimated the popularity of the trail, and made it a bit too narrow for folks to enjoy. It seems like when you have a lot of people on there, passing bicycles and even walkers can be challenging, if there are folk coming the other way.

There really also ought to be some bathrooms along the trail, maybe a porta-potty or an outhouse. Just a quick, private place to take a tinkle.
